BizCap is the small business lending service of County Corp Development and was founded in 1981 as a private not-for-profit development corporation committed to supporting economic development in the region. Through County Corp Development we expanded our mission to work on business expansion opportunities and fill financial gaps for small businesses.  County Corp Development makes business loans through United States Small Business Administration (SBA) 504, Ohio Regional 166, and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) funding. In addition, we also have funds available for Child Day Care loans. Funding is used for facilities expansion and equipment needs. Our loans are tailored to meet the specific needs of small businesses. The loan amounts range from $25,000 to $5,500,000 and offer low, fixed interest rates.

As one of the most respected development organizations in the state, County Corp Development is a Certified Development Company authorized by the SBA since 1982, and has made Ohio Regional 166 Loans since 1991.

County Corp Development is authorized to make Regional 166 loans throughout Ohio and SBA 504 loans anywhere in Ohio and  Fayette, Franklin, Jay, Randolph, Union & Wayne Counties in Indiana. CDBG & Child Day Care loans are limited at this time to businesses within Montgomery County.
